Why would you relocate your battery for a D16Z?!?!
Anyway, for the B16A I personally wouldn't use most D series intakes (AEM, etc) because the intake itself is actually smaller than the TB! What good is that? If you don't want to relocate your battery I think you have about 2 options.
1) A lot of people are using intakes from the 90-93 Tegs. They are for B series motors and they're bigger in diameter (I believe its 2.75") and they're bent perfectly so they should fit around your battery. I've never heard of one not fitting.
2) Injen CAI for an 88-91 CRX Si. The piping is the same size as the 99-00Si (again, I believe its 2.75") and you won't have to move your battery for this one. I don't know why, but injen just made the piping for this intake bigger than all the other companys.. Works for me. :) That what I'm going to get when the time comes.. I had my old shorty that I had on my ZC when I dropped my B16 in, but it was just too damn small, so I took it off and replaced it with a stock one with a modded airbox. :)
